With 2,000 square feet of display area, we showcase an array of artists working in all kinds of mediums to produce unique, edgy, and engaging contemporary pieces — all of them for sale.

  

In addition to our two packed floors of antiques, vintage, collectibles, and more in the Staunton Antiques Center, our upper level Artisans Loft offers a stunning look into the local art and artisan world in our region.

The Artisans Loft presents four juried and curated shows a year on a quarterly basis. Artists submit works and our board juries submissions for final selection.

When each new show opens, we host a Friday evening opening. Our openings are lively affairs including local live music, food, occasional theatricals, and merriment of all sorts. See our blog/events page for details on the current and next shows.

Zewd's store has antique Ethiopian handicrafts such as furniture, baskets, traditional dresses and fabrics, jewelry, art pieces and so much more!

  

Zewd’s store has antique Ethiopian handicrafts such as furniture, baskets, traditional dresses and fabrics, jewelry, art pieces and so much more!

Zewdinesh Mengistu was born and raised in the vibrant capital of Ethiopia, Addis Ababa, a center for international diplomacy, trade and arts for the African continent. Growing up, she was inspired by her upbringing and her mother’s love for handicrafts, to pursue her passion.

Small Town, Big Culture!

  

Staunton is the perfect base from which to explore Virginia’s Shenandoah Valley and the Blue Ridge Mountains. The city’s charming downtown is home to a vibrant arts and music scene, a sizzling reputation for local food and dining, and an array of independent shops and galleries clustered along the historic Main Street.

Discover Staunton's dragons while you explore multiple historic landmarks on this self-guided family walking tour.

  

There are Dragons in Staunton! Pick up a copy of the Myth & Magic Quest Field Guide to Staunton and explore Staunton’s true history plus its Dragon “mythstory”! Follow the map to discover where Dragons still dwell throughout the town. Record the clues you find and return to unlock your reward.
